1
0
mirror of https://github.com/MariaDB/server.git synced 2025-08-08 11:22:35 +03:00

Fix that BACKUP STAGE BLOCK_COMMIT flushes binary log

This commit is contained in:
Monty
2019-10-30 17:41:39 +02:00
parent fcd65b0376
commit 366f4f299e
3 changed files with 48 additions and 0 deletions

View File

@@ -0,0 +1,21 @@
#
# Test BACKUP STAGES BLOCK_COMMIT with binary logging on
#
SET BINLOG_FORMAT=MIXED;
RESET MASTER;
create table t1 (a int) engine=aria;
insert into t1 values (1);
BACKUP STAGE START;
BACKUP STAGE BLOCK_COMMIT;
SELECT @@gtid_binlog_pos;
@@gtid_binlog_pos
0-1-2
BACKUP STAGE END;
include/show_binlog_events.inc
Log_name Pos Event_type Server_id End_log_pos Info
master-bin.000001 # Gtid # # GTID #-#-#
master-bin.000001 # Query # # use `test`; create table t1 (a int) engine=aria
master-bin.000001 # Gtid # # BEGIN GTID #-#-#
master-bin.000001 # Query # # use `test`; insert into t1 values (1)
master-bin.000001 # Query # # COMMIT
drop table t1;